Malawi Problem

More
21 Sep 2007 22:20 #1 by KenS (Ken Simpson)
I appear to have developed a disease in my Malawi tank over the last week. At this stage, I've lost four fish, 3 sprengerae and 1 Otopharynx.

I had noticed odd behaviour in the sprengerae a few weeks back where they were breathing very heavily - gills and mouths going rapidly. I checked them the next day and they were fine.

Over the last week, three of the sprengerae went off their food, turned dark and died within a few days of each other. The Otopharanx also died today. Syptoms they had in common were rapid breathing, loss of appetite and turned dark. The Otopharanx also bloated. I didn't notice this in the sprengerae.

I'm not sure which fish brought this into the tank. I suspect the sprengerae as they were the first to show symptoms.

Earlier in the week, I treid treating with eSHa 2000 which is a good broad spectrum treatment. However, it doesn't appear to have helped.

I now have several other fish off their food which isn't good.

Doing a search, this looks as though it could be bloat or internal bacteria. I have some Metrodinazole and am wondering whether it's worth a try. I'll probably have to treat the whole tank as several fish seem to be affected by it.

Any thoughts?

Regular small water changes
Feed very little food
Go ahead with the metro
Aerate the water as much as possible

It may be a case of it being a last chance for a lot of the fish.
